Output d131736154d4b1b595f52758f4200a70d18d32cd5c6dba33281b75ff1699b477:1

value
20305500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17dbe4496c2bd689d85d1c4afef582a0376748d OP_EQUAL
address
A8cku8tRxHj4hcPdzMvijEWRNqUvXR3vw5
transaction
d131736154d4b1b595f52758f4200a70d18d32cd5c6dba33281b75ff1699b477